As a Romanian,I feel like it's my duty to clarify a few things.
So many people on this site asked me to turn them into vampires or claim to be vampires,there is no such thing.

Vlad Dracul(which means Vlad the Devil)ruled a region in Romania and he was as cruel as a person could get,since he would impale servants for simply daring to look into his eyes.

After his violent death,villagers were still afraid of Vlad as they though that he would come back to haunt them under a supernatural form.
Many bodies,after their death undergo changes,as you well know,and fluids such as blood surface on the dead person's mouth.

Now we have a tradition that goes like this:if the person who died murdered people or committed suicide then it's bound to transform into a varcolac(werewolf) or vampir(vampire),so the next night,they gather around the grave,unburry the corpse and burn its heart to prevent it from transforming.This whole mad ritual started because people still don't know that blood may come out of the corpse's mouth and the nails and hair keep growing a few months after the death.

Now Dracula is our ruler(one and the same person),but known under this name,because the Irish Bram Stoker decided to turn this murderer into a fictional character,because he found out about our tradition,he heard some stories from the villagers claiming to have seen the corpses with spots of blood on their faces and so on.

That's it,guys,there's no Dracula,it's just a novel,there are no sanguinarian vampires.
